 English Version The Impact of Childhood Trauma on Auditory Hallucinations in Adulthood Abstract: Childhood trauma is a significant factor influencing long-term mental health. One of its lesser-known effects is the potential to experience auditory hallucinations in adulthood. This article explores how trauma in early life can contribute to these symptoms, looking at both biological and psychological pathways, research findings, and therapeutic interventions. Introduction: Childhood trauma, such as abuse, neglect, or loss, can have profound effects on mental health. These experiences can disrupt brain development and increase vulnerability to mental health issues like anxiety, depression, and, in some cases, hallucinations. Auditory hallucinations, or hearing voices that aren't there, are particularly concerning. Understanding the link between childhood trauma and hallucinations can aid in better mental health support.
